The foot switch has about 10 pieces. You should be able to stand by the drivers front tire and grab the firewall side of the pedal. Pull there and see if the starter works. There is a long bar that goes over the back of the engine and then back down to the starter. I think I have a picture that shows it good. Look for the stuff around the tunnel opening.

I ordered a new switch from White Owl and it was the correct one but it turns out I didn't need it. The rod had jumped over the linkage next to the starter with that cross over bar that Barrman had mentioned. Pryed it back over and hopefully it'll stay put.
